Khir Al-Madinah Waqf Distributes Over 1.6 Million Iftar Meals and Food Items in Madinah

Madinah: The Khir Al-Madinah Waqf concluded its 1447 AH activities after distributing more than 1.6 million iftar meals and food items, along with over 2.2 million bottles of water, as part of its programs to serve beneficiaries and pilgrims in Madinah. The endowment's services also included distributing approximately 66 tons of dates, 24 tons of fruit, more than 1.7 million baked goods, and around 400,000 cups of Saudi coffee and tea.

According to Saudi Press Agency, the distributions were carried out at several locations across Madinah, including the Prophet's Mosque, Quba Mosque, Al-Qiblatain Mosque, Sayed Al-Shuhada Mosque, Miqat Dhu Al-Hulayfah, as well as a number of mosques, hospitals, Prince Mohammad Bin Abdulaziz International Airport, and the Haramain High Speed Railway station.

The programs were implemented by 137 staff members in partnership with the Takaful charitable society for orphan care. The initiative also provided opportunities for 689 volunteers, who contributed 5,236 hours.
